Tier d'Aussai from On is a climb in the region Forest of Saint-Hubert. It is 2.7 km long and bridges 120 m of vertical ascent with an average gradient of 4.5%, resulting in a difficulty score of 80. The top of the ascent is located at 320 m above sea level. Climbfinder users shared 2 reviews of this climb and uploaded 3 photos.
Road names: Thier des Soeurs, Place Capitaine Mostenne, Rue Jean Jadot & Allée des Moineaux

Quite a long climb, with a very steep footing (especially as there's a bend in the road and you don't have any momentum). The rest of the route winds first through the village and then into the countryside. Beautiful views at the top.
The road is in good condition, with little traffic.

Heavier climb than it looks. Part of La Magnifique. Fairly irregular, reasonable tarmac. You ride the steepest parts in the forest. Nice climb in summary
